As part of the Cultural Olympiad, the Théâtre de la Ville and the Théâtre du Châtelet are offering a special program of art and sport to coincide with the Fête de la Musique, from June 21st to 23rd.
This year, the City of Paris has entrusted internationally renowned artists such as Claire Tancons, Mohammed El Khatib, Benjamin Millepied and Raymond Depardon to bring the Cultural Olympiad to life. Having already started in April, their task is to take over Parisian public spaces during festivities and events. In addition to these major unifying events, the City of Paris will be setting up festive sites in every arrondissement throughout the summer as part of the "Paris fête les Jeux" program. With event broadcasts, sports classes, shows and free entertainment, Parisians and visitors from all over the world will experience Parisian fervor.
From June 21st to 23rd, the Théâtre de la Ville and the Théâtre du Châtelet will be offering a tailor-made program to punctuate this festive weekend:
- The Théâtre du Châtelet takes us on a joyful, fraternal world tour with Danses des cinq continents, a show featuring six amateur traditional dance groups who have kept the musical and choreographic practices of their countries and regions of origin alive (South America, Burundi, Armenia, Japan, France, Polynesia).
- On the Place du Châtelet, the Théâtre de la Ville will present an expanded version of Mohamed El Khatib's play Stadium, with 53 FC Lens supporters giving spectators a taste of in the overexcited atmosphere of a soccer match, and paying a powerful tribute to the beautiful game and all those who dedicate their lives to it.
Both shows will end with a festive finale on Place du Châtelet, featuring the Stadium brass band and the Batuc'ados de Colombes.
At the same time, the Better Call So agency will be setting up the Labyrinthe des Jeux, a fun, offbeat course accessible for all, on the Place du Châtelet, with sporting challenges for all ages.
